Abstract
Superior pancreaticoduodenal artery aneurysms are rare; their rupture often leads to sudden death. We report a case of a 59-year-old hypertensive man who died of a massive retroperitoneal hemorrhage following rupture of an aneurysm of the superior pancreaticoduodenal artery. We also discuss this unusual vascular lesion and review the pertinent literature.
